After introducing this in 2024, we’re adding the 3-06 perennial ground cover program to our catalog in 2025. We start and bulk up these perennials in the summer and then overwinter them at near-freezing temperatures. They wake up as the spring temperatures climb and we ship them to you with your last liner orders of the spring. Handle and variety tags included with each 6-pack, you receive them ready to set directly on your retail benches. See pages 132-133 for full program information. BOOK YOUR ORDER EARLY! Receiving your MYP catalog in July gives you time to plan your season and book your orders. This booking cycle begins at the end of July for orders shipping weeks 40-20. Give your growing season a successful start by booking your order early and taking advantage of these benefits: EARLY ORDER DISCOUNT (EOD) Early Order Discount (EOD): An early order discount (EOD) lowers the cost of your plants and applies to all orders booked by October 31, 2024. We recommend placing as much of your initial order as early as you can. You can always add a product later if you make additions or changes to your program but ordering early ensures that the bulk of your order is confirmed with the EOD pricing. SELECTION AND AVAILABILITY Good availability earlier in the season means it’s more likely you’ll get your entire order confirmed. Our trays are grown to order, and we book orders with the cutting suppliers after receiving orders from your broker. Suppliers have a limited number of cuttings, and once they are gone, we cannot get more. ORDER PROTECTION Order Protection: Booking early helps to protect your order from unexpected shortages arising during production.

OUR LIVING CATALOG

OUR 2024 TRIAL GARDEN WILL FEATURE: • 500 unique and custom designed combinations in hanging baskets, deco planters, and window boxes • 140+ new varieties from top industry breeders displayed in sun and shade beds and containers • AAS trial garden • 2024 ‘Plants Per Pot’ trial. You asked and we listened! We will be growing out some of our favorite varieties in our standard containers using different numbers of plants per pot. Use this trial to help decide the ideal number of plants-per-pot for your greenhouse. • 2024 ‘Cultural Fertilization’ trial. You asked about the feed we apply to the pots in the garden, and we’ll be growing some of our top varieties with clear water, standard feed, and some slow-release rates. • 2024 ‘Foliage in Full Sun’ trial. We are growing out tropical varieties in full sun to see how they perform. • Shaded seating with wireless internet available. • Our customer appreciation day will be held on Thursday August 15, 2024. Make plans to join us for garden tours, dinner, games with prizes, and more! Reservations for this event are preferred and can be made at customercare@mastyoungplants.com or by calling 1-800-541-3910. We invite you to follow along with updates on our website and on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n. Our 2024 trial garden report will be published to our website in October. Check back there to see which of the new for 2025 varieties really stood out this summer! What’s better than this catalog full of pictures of beautiful plants? A living catalog you see, smell, and touch by browsing through aisles and acres of beautiful plants! We call our summer trial garden a “living catalog” because it is where we field trial the varieties that we offer in our program. This allows us to see plants’ performance in actual garden conditions, compare genetics across varieties, evaluate new introductions, and appraise the performance of novel combinations. Our trial garden gives you confidence in your selections. Rather than choosing varieties for our program from breeder photo galleries, we carefully select from the varieties that meet our high standard for quality and which we are confident we can grow well for you. Master Boxes are 48” long by 48” wide and can be anywhere from 21” tall (single stack box) to 48” tall (double stack box) to 70” tall (triple stack box). The weight is anywhere from 150 lbs up to 467 lbs based on the size of the order. Master boxes are delivered by XPO or FedEx Freight services. In most cases a loading dock, forklift or skid steer is required to be able to off load the Master Box from the semi-trailer. Any orders that exceed 3 Standard Boxes, MYP will automatically ship in the Master Box unless otherwise specified by the recipient. Freight is billed per tray.

MYP TRUCK Deliveries that ship via our MYP truck will arrive in a 53’ semitruck with a temperature-controlled trailer. Trays will arrive on a wheeled CC cart measuring 22” wide x 53” long x 81” tall. A thermal blanket draped over the entire rack and plants will help keep the plants safe from cold temperatures during offloading. The cart, once offloaded, will be returned to the trailer. Freight is billed per tray. Please refer to our ordering guidelines (page 9) for the MYP truck delivery schedule - based on our shipping zones and the minimum tray requirements. The CC carts are on a wheeled base so they do not require a forklift to move them. The dimensions are: 22” w X 53” long X 81” h.
